
检测的重要性和背景介绍
收费公路联网收费系统是保障路网高效运行、资金准确清分与服务质量的核心基础设施。作为其关键组成部分,路段收费(分)中心软件承担着本路段内所有收费站交易数据的汇聚、处理、存储、上传及业务管理职责,其性能表现直接关系到车道通行效率、数据完整性与结算的及时准确。因此,对该软件进行专业、系统的性能测试检测,是验证系统承载能力、发现潜在瓶颈、确保联网收费系统在大交通量下稳定可靠运行的不可或缺的环节。
此项检测对于保障系统安全稳定、控制软件质量、满足行业监管要求具有关键作用。通过模拟真实业务压力,能够有效评估软件在高并发、大数据量场景下的响应能力、处理精度及资源利用效率,防止因软件性能不足导致的交易丢失、响应迟缓甚至系统崩溃,从而确保通行费应收尽收,维护公路运营者与用户的合法权益,支撑路网的科学管理与服务水平的持续提升。
具体的检测项目和范围
本性能测试检测主要围绕软件的关键性能指标展开,具体检测项目包括:事务处理能力(如每秒成功处理交易数TPS)、并发用户支持能力、系统响应时间(平均、峰值及百分位数)、业务处理成功率、数据存储与查询性能、网络吞吐量、CPU及内存资源利用率等。检测范围覆盖软件在典型及峰值业务负载下的表现,涉及从收费站数据上传至(分)中心处理、存储、统计、上传至省中心的完整数据流。测试对象为部署在真实或等效仿真环境中的路段收费(分)中心软件系统,包括其数据库、应用服务、接口服务等所有核心组件。
使用的检测仪器和设备
完成此项检测需要专业的性能测试工具套件作为核心设备。该套件通常包含压力负载生成器、性能监控与分析软件等。负载生成器用于模拟海量收费站终端及上级中心系统,产生符合业务逻辑的并发请求,以施加可控的压力负载。性能监控工具则用于实时采集被测系统的各项资源指标(如服务器CPU、内存、磁盘I/O、网络带宽)及软件应用层的具体性能数据。这些设备需具备高精度计时、低资源开销、可灵活定制测试场景脚本以及强大的结果分析能力,以确保测试数据的准确性与可靠性。
标准检测方法和流程
标准的检测流程遵循严谨的工程方法。首先,需明确测试目标与场景,依据业务模型设计详细的测试用例,包括日常流水、高峰流水、清算对账等。随后,搭建独立的测试环境,其硬件、软件及网络配置应与实际生产环境等效或明确折算关系。在正式测试前,需对测试工具进行校准,并对被测系统进行数据初始化与预热。
具体测试步骤采用循序渐进的负载模式:先进行基准测试,获取系统在无压力下的性能基线;再进行负载测试,逐步增加并发用户数或业务量,观察性能变化趋势;接着进行稳定性测试(耐力测试),在高压下持续运行一定时间,检测系统是否存在内存泄漏或性能衰减;最后,执行压力测试与极限测试,探索系统的性能边界与失效点。整个过程中,需完整记录每一负载级别下的性能指标与系统资源状态。
相关的技术标准和规范
本检测工作主要依据国家及行业相关标准规范开展,主要包括:《GB/T25000.51-2016系统与软件工程系统与软件质量要求和评价(SQuaRE)第51部分:就绪可用软件产品(RUSP)的质量要求和测试细则》、《JT/T1328-2020收费公路联网收费系统软件测试规程》等。这些标准规范为性能测试的指标定义、方法选择、环境构建、过程管理和结果评价提供了权威的技术依据,确保了检测工作的科学性、规范性和结果的可比性,是保障联网收费系统软件质量符合行业准入与运营要求的基石。
检测结果的评判标准
检测结果的评判基于预定的性能需求与目标。首先,核心性能指标(如关键事务平均响应时间、交易成功率)必须满足设计规格说明书或合同规定的阈值要求。其次,在长时间稳定性测试中,系统错误率需低于可接受范围,且资源利用率(如CPU、内存)应保持相对稳定,无持续增长的趋势,表明系统无严重资源泄漏。最后,系统在峰值负载下不应出现功能性故障或服务不可用的情况。
性能评估通常分为“符合要求”、“基本符合但存在风险”和“不符合要求”等等级。结果报告应详细包含测试环境配置、测试场景与用例描述、负载模型、详细的性能数据图表(如响应时间曲线、吞吐量曲线、资源监控图)、性能瓶颈分析(如发现)、与预期目标的对比结论以及改进建议。报告需客观呈现测试数据配资炒股网选,为软件部署上线或优化升级提供确切的决策依据。
爱配资提示:文章来自网络,不代表本站观点。